Attendees: sales leads, product, finance.

Discussion covered the proposed "Meridian Plus" tier for Fenwick Analytics. Pricing lands between Core and Enterprise, targeting mid-market accounts that outgrow Core limits. Finance confirmed margin modeling is complete; product committed to feature gating by end of quarter. Sales leads will prepare battlecards and identify fifty pilot accounts. Launch communications are embargoed until the regional kickoff in Ostbury. The confidential summary of related business plans appears directly below.

internal memo for hahaf-kahof: Only 39 of the 428 pilot accounts renewed Sorion, so a churn review is set for April 12. Praokix Freight is in early talks to buy Queniusox Group for about $145.8 million.

Snapshots are regenerated only through the blessed CI job; local regeneration is disabled to prevent platform-specific diffs. When a snapshot fails, first confirm the change is intentional, then attach the visual diff to the review before approving. Flaky snapshots — usually animation timing — should be quarantined, not deleted, so we keep the coverage record honest. The quarantine procedure, current flaky list, and regeneration steps are documented on the Quillset testing page.

runbook for badug-kadup: https://confluence.zemvarlabs.internal/projects/browse/display/projects/bd1b

## Step 4: Configure deep-link routing

Before merging, confirm the Lintbridge app's route manifest maps every marketing path to a handler, including the fallback to the home screen. Verify the association file is served over the canary domain and that link validation passes locally. The deploy must be signed with the key that follows.

deploy key for yahag-kawip: bky9_VGNU8B7oS

**Ticket: TumbleStash vault locked — locker access flow blocked**

Hi new folks, welcome to a classic. The secrets vault backing the TumbleStash laundry-locker access flow locked itself overnight, so locker-open tokens aren't being issued. Residents can't grab their laundry, which is as fun as it sounds. Unlock is manual — follow the runbook and enter the recovery passphrase shown just below.

unlock words, tagaf-hahif: ralwyn-lammir-rusax-sormir